Christmas budgets: How much 'should' you spend?

I've been thinking alot about spending recently.  This is to be expected in the run up to Christmas, especially in the current financial climate.*   My hubby and I have set ourselves strict budgets, as we did last year, and although I feel somewhat cruel monitoring our spend so closely, it is unfortunately the way it has to be to ensure we don't end up in debt.

But, through casual conversations with other mums, I have realised that everyone has 'completely ridiculous different' ideas as to how much they should spend on their children.

So it got me to thinking.  What is an appropriate total spend per child for this magical day?



*Translation:  cash-strapped, debt-ridden nation, that spent far more than we could afford and are now having to pay for it.
